I just want to 36 00:08:47,990 --> 00:08:52,270 quickly go over the audit itself. Remind members of Council 37 00:08:52,310 --> 00:08:54,990 that we are appointed by the township to perform an 38 00:08:54,990 --> 00:08:59,618 audit. We do the audit in accordance with Canadian Auditing 39 00:08:59,618 --> 00:09:03,218 Standards. Those standards were not, have not changed since last 40 00:09:03,218 --> 00:09:06,498 year. And so our audit approach was consistent. The statements 41 00:09:06,538 --> 00:09:10,178 themselves are prepared in accordance with Canadian Public Sector Accounting 42 00:09:10,178 --> 00:09:14,338 Standards. There were no significant changes to those standards from 43 00:09:14,359 --> 00:09:17,618 last year. And so you're accounting policies that were used 44 00:09:17,618 --> 00:09:20,338 to prepare this year's statements are consistent with those in 45 00:09:20,338 --> 00:09:24,384 the previous year. As I mentioned, we have completed the 46 00:09:24,405 --> 00:09:28,544 audit. Our audit looks at everything. We don't just pick 47 00:09:28,544 --> 00:09:32,864 a few accounts and test those. But we do identify 48 00:09:33,045 --> 00:09:35,744 for you, those areas where we think there's either a 49 00:09:35,744 --> 00:09:39,671 little greater risk or they're more complicated. So the errors 50 00:09:39,692 --> 00:09:45,431 we identified for risk revenue into third revenue. Those are 51 00:09:45,471 --> 00:09:48,391 significant because Canadian Auditing Standards say we have to treat 52 00:09:48,412 --> 00:09:52,451 them that way. When it comes to a municipality, the 53 00:09:52,451 --> 00:09:57,631 biggest risk is specifically with recognition of deferred amounts. So 54 00:09:57,631 --> 00:10:01,831 development charge revenue, revenue, you would be receiving from certain 55 00:10:01,932 --> 00:10:05,991 types of reserve funds that are obligatory as a term 56 00:10:06,031 --> 00:10:10,551 we used. You can only recognise revenue from those revenue 57 00:10:10,591 --> 00:10:14,151 streams when you incur eligible expenses. And so that's an 58 00:10:14,151 --> 00:10:17,091 area where we tend to focus a lot on. And 59 00:10:17,091 --> 00:10:19,471 our testing in those areas this year was fine. No 60 00:10:19,471 --> 00:10:25,261 issues were identified. Management override of controls. Is another area 61 00:10:25,301 --> 00:10:28,301 where accounting standards require us to treat it as a 62 00:10:28,301 --> 00:10:31,101 significant risk. The idea being there is a risk that 63 00:10:31,202 --> 00:10:35,581 management could override a system. You have internal controls in 64 00:10:35,621 --> 00:10:38,381 place. We look at those controls and we're satisfied with 65 00:10:38,421 --> 00:10:41,421 them. But there is always a risk that management would 66 00:10:41,461 --> 00:10:44,781 attempt to override those controls. We do specific testing in 67 00:10:44,781 --> 00:10:49,581 that area to address that, primarily journal entry testing. We 68 00:10:49,581 --> 00:10:52,461 will identify all the journal entries that were posted during 69 00:10:52,501 --> 00:10:55,821 the year. We then profile those entries looking for certain 70 00:10:56,002 --> 00:10:59,821 characteristics. If the characteristics are present, we then select those 71 00:10:59,922 --> 00:11:02,941 entries and take a closer look at them, making sure 72 00:11:02,941 --> 00:11:06,621 they were properly prepared, approved and posted, but primarily we're 73 00:11:06,661 --> 00:11:09,741 looking at it from a business perspective, does this entry 74 00:11:09,781 --> 00:11:13,421 actually make sense. That testing was completed, no issues or 75 00:11:13,421 --> 00:11:16,621 concerns were identified. There is no indication of managements over 76 00:11:16,722 --> 00:11:19,302 out of control. Uh, and the third item that was 77 00:11:19,342 --> 00:11:22,582 listed was, um, with regards to year and accruals and 78 00:11:22,622 --> 00:11:24,984 other estimates. And this is a common one that we 79 00:11:25,024 --> 00:11:28,945 would put in any of our audit plans. Uh, simply 80 00:11:28,945 --> 00:11:30,705 because there are certain amounts at the end of a 81 00:11:30,705 --> 00:11:34,545 year where management does have to estimate. Uh, your provision 82 00:11:34,646 --> 00:11:39,905 front collectible taxes, um, uh, tools for salaries, wages or 83 00:11:39,905 --> 00:11:44,025 other potential liabilities. Um, and because those are estimates, we 84 00:11:44,025 --> 00:11:45,985 can't verify it a hundred percent when we do the 85 00:11:45,985 --> 00:11:48,225 audit. So for those areas, what we do is we 86 00:11:48,265 --> 00:11:51,265 just assess the process that was undertaken to come up 87 00:11:51,265 --> 00:11:53,585 with the estimate. We take a look at the backup 88 00:11:53,766 --> 00:11:56,385 supporting the estimate. And we conclude whether or not we 89 00:11:56,406 --> 00:11:59,265 believe those estimates are reasonable based on all the information 90 00:11:59,526 --> 00:12:03,025 that's available. And based on our testing, no issues are 91 00:12:03,065 --> 00:12:07,905 concerns were identified. Um, in terms of the audit itself, 92 00:12:07,905 --> 00:12:10,785 as I mentioned largely finished, we don't audit a hundred 93 00:12:10,785 --> 00:12:14,305 percent of all transactions. We are in fact, uh, auditing 94 00:12:14,345 --> 00:12:18,890 to a materiality level. Um, the materiali level that was 95 00:12:18,890 --> 00:12:21,610 set for this year's audit was 600, 000 dollars that 96 00:12:21,650 --> 00:12:24,650 is consistent with last year's What that means is if 97 00:12:24,690 --> 00:12:29,770 we find errors that individually or cumulatively exceed 600, 000, 98 00:12:29,770 --> 00:12:31,610 we would not be in a position to provide you 99 00:12:31,631 --> 00:12:35,450 with a clean or unmodified audit opinion. Uh, if you've 100 00:12:35,471 --> 00:12:37,850 looked at the draft, you will notice that the opinion 101 00:12:38,031 --> 00:12:41,690 we're proposing is a clean, unmodified opinion, indicating that we 102 00:12:41,791 --> 00:12:45,770 did not identify any, uh, significant errors or we didn't 103 00:12:45,791 --> 00:12:49,210 identify any actually, um, and so, uh, we will be 104 00:12:49,210 --> 00:12:53,530 able to provide a clean, unmodified opinion once we wrap 105 00:12:53,551 --> 00:12:56,650 things up for good.
